Instructions for the Wall Flowers Wall Hanging

 

0

 

 

Notions

 

 

Stitch out the Following designs

 

 

 

1

 

With the 1 x 1 meter or 3.5 x 3.5 feet of white cotton backing fabric mark the centre

 

 

2

 

Print out in “Actual size” “Bright Flowers_01” and “Bright Flowers_02”

 

 

3

 

Mark the centre of your “Actual size” print out

 

 

4

 

Cut around the design

 

 

5

 

• Place on the centre of the fabric “Bright Flowers_01” and “Bright Flowers_02”
• I first of all place “Bright Flowers_02” first then place “Bright Flowers_01” under just slightly “Bright Flowers_02”
• Place a pin through the centre of the print outs as to where you would like the flowers to be on the fabric and mark the fabric with either chalk or fabric marker pen

 

 

6

 

8

 

 

 

9

 

• Place the hoop as close to the centre as you can to stitch out “Bright Flower_02”
• Repeat the process to the left of “Bright Flower_01 and 02” stitch out “Bright Flower_07 and 08”
• Repeat the process to the right of “Bright Flower_01 and 02” stitch out “Bright Flower_09 and 10”
• Repeat the process to the right of “Bright flower_09 and 10” stitch out “Bright Flower_05 and _06”
• Repeat the process to the left of “Bright Flower_07 and 08” stitch out “Bright Flower_03 and 04” or if you find this all too confusing look at the photo :)

 

 

10

 

• To place the bird, ladybeetle, cat and butterfly the following instructions may help
• Print out “Actual size” for the bird and others
• Mark the centre of the print out

 

 

11

 

Place the design where you would like it and put a pin through the centre of the print out

 

 

12

 

 

 

13

 

The photo shows how I placed the designs “Bright Flowers_11 through to 15” on the fabric

 

 

14

 

I used a fabric glue to place the square designs onto the background fabric, do not put too much glue on the squares just in the centre so you can easily move the squares till you get a perfect fit surrounding the centre designs

 

 

15

 

I did not glue down the bottom section fully as I need to put the fabric under the bottom layer of squares

 

 

16

 

Press the two fabrics

 

 

17

 

Pin the fabric down under the squares

 

 

 

18

 

Stitch the striped and polka dot fabric down to the background fabric

Wall Flower Cushion Bag

 

23

 

Notions

 

 

Stitch out the following designs

 

Hoop

 

 

24

 

 

 

25

 

You can see in the photo I have once again stitched in black thread, straight stitch which are the measurements for the front of the bag, this is where I will cut the fabric.

It might be best to check your measurements for the front of the bag once you have put the side panels and bottom panels together, as measurements can vary on what stabilizers you use and fabrics etc.

 

Measurements for the front of the bag

Width 25.8 cm or 10.15 inches approx
Length 28.4 cm or 11.18 inches approx

 

 

26

 

Front of the bag cut with scissors along the black thread straight stitch

 

 

27

 

• Cut out “Stitch N Shape” the same size as the front of the bag
• Put under the front of the bag the “Stitch N Shape” zigzag stitch around the front of the bag

 

 

28

 

After you stitched the zigzag stitch you then go over the zigzag stitch with a satin stitch

 

29

 

• Using your zigzag stitch, stitch the two “Bag top_bot” together
• Stitch the two “Bag top front” together
• Stitch “Bag top_bot” to “Bag top front”

 

 

30

 

Stitch all 4 “Bag back” together

 

 

31

 

32

 

33

 

• Stitch the two “Bag side” together for both sides
• Stitch the tow “Bag side” to the front panel

 

 

34

 

35

 

Stitch once side of the side panels to the back panel

 

 

36

 

Stitch the “Bag top_bot” to the front panel

 

 

37

 

Stitching the “Bag top_bot” together

 

 

38

 

Stitch the top panel to the back panel

 

 

39

 

Top panel stitched to the back panel

 

 

40

 

First stitch the bottom panel to the side panel

 

 

41

 

Stitched the bottom panel to the side panel

 

 

42

 

Stitch the back panel to the side panel

 

 

43

 

Stitch the other side of the bag, stitching side panel to the bottom panel

 

 

44

 

Stitching the side panel to the bottom panel

 

 

45

 

Stitching the side panel to the back panel, all done!!!!!!!!!

 

46

 

TIP
If you have any white thread or fabric showing you can always use a permanent marker to cover
